"...but rather a myth perpetuated by TurboTax because the software doesn't support dual state residence."
First, you're commenting on an almost 5-year-old thread. Second, no one at TurboTax has ever denied that dual residence is possible. A taxpayer can certainly be both a domiciliary resident of one state and at the same time a statutory resident of another. The TT software isn't set up well to handle dual residency, but TT isn't "perpetuating" any "myth" about it.
